Frequently Asked Questions about San Dimas
How much are Studio apartments in San Dimas?
There are currently 124 Studio Apartments in San Dimas with rent ranges from $1,450 to $2,365 with an average price of $1,845.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om San Dimas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in San Dimas ranges from $1,375 to $3,500 with an average monthly rent of $2,090.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in San Dimas c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in San Dimas range from $1,945 to $3,960.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,656.
How expensive are San Dimas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 88 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in San Dimas on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,500 to $4,030 - averaging $3,269 for the location.
